The Berlin Steel Construction Company is a full-service specialty contractor, primarily with structural steel and miscellaneous metals. We design, fabricate, and erect structures in the Northeast and in other parts of the country. We have 2 fabrication facilities, 4 erection operations facilities, and 6 office locations that provide engineering and management of projects. We are a 100% employee‑owned company (ESOP) with a desire for growth. We service the private commercial, public, institutional, and industrial markets.
